"In the Heart of the Sea" is a visually stunning historical action-adventure directed by Ron Howard, bringing to life the incredible true story that inspired Herman Melville's classic novel, Moby-Dick. Released in 2015, the film stars Chris Hemsworth as the veteran whaler Owen Chase and features a talented supporting cast including Cillian Murphy and a young Tom Holland. Movie Overview & Plot Summary
The story is set in 1820 and follows the harrowing voyage of the New England whaling ship Essex. The crew faces an unthinkable assault by a mammoth bull sperm whale with an almost human sense of vengeance, leaving them shipwrecked and adrift in the vast Pacific Ocean.
Plot: Forced to confront starvation, storms, and their own humanity, the survivors must resort to extreme measures to stay alive. Characters:
Owen Chase (Chris Hemsworth): The skilled first mate who clashes with his inexperienced captain. in the heart of the sea movie hindi dubbed exclusive
George Pollard (Benjamin Walker): The captain whose family name secured his position over Chase.
Thomas Nickerson (Tom Holland/Brendan Gleeson): The cabin boy through whose eyes the story is told to author Herman Melville. Hindi Dubbed Version Details

Introduction
"In the Heart of the Sea" is a 2015 historical action-adventure film directed by Ron Howard. The movie is based on the 2000 non-fiction book of the same name by Nathaniel Philbrick, which tells the story of the whaleship Essex and its crew, who were attacked by a massive sperm whale in 1820. The film stars Chris Hemsworth, Tom Holland, and Ben Whishaw.
The True Story Behind the Movie
The movie is based on the true story of the whaleship Essex, which set sail from Nantucket in 1820. The ship was attacked by a massive sperm whale on November 20, 1820, while sailing in the Pacific Ocean. The whale's attack caused significant damage to the ship, leading to its sinking. The crew of 21 men was forced to survive on small boats, facing extreme hardships, including starvation, dehydration, and shark attacks. Only eight men survived, with some of them resorting to cannibalism to stay alive.
The Making of the Movie
The film's script was written by Charles Leavens and Tom Ward, with Drew Pearce contributing to the story. Chris Hemsworth, who played the lead role of Owen Chase, the first mate of the Essex, had to undergo extensive training to prepare for the physically demanding role.
